The function of Questions: How Effective Questions Can Change the Game Effective questioning is the key to successful and result-oriented coaching. The questions in coaching have to be drafted to generate responsibility and awareness in the coachee. It ultimately falls upon the skills and competencies of the coach. Asking just any question is not enough; the coach needs to assess its effectiveness and frame it accordingly.
The Importance of Questioning in Coaching Questions in coaching are supposed to provoke thoughts and information. In coaching, questions generate required information from the coachee. The answers lead the coach to follow a pattern of consecutive questioning and assess the session-wise progress of the coachee.
